What Are Vacuum System Parts and Why Are They Essential?
Vacuum system parts encompass a broad range of hardware, from pumps and gauges to membranes, valves, and fittings. These components work synergistically to maintain, control, and monitor the vacuum environment. Their proper selection directly impacts the system's performance, including its capacity to handle continuous operation and exposure to various chemicals or materials.
Types of Vacuum System Parts
- Vacuum Pumps: Devices that create and sustain vacuum conditions, including dry vane pumps, rotary vane pumps, and liquid ring pumps.
- Vacuum Membranes: Flexible barrier layers like silicone membranes and natural rubber membranes that interface with the process environment.
- Valves and Fittings: Regulate airflow, pressure, and vacuum levels within the system.
- Gauges and Sensors: Monitor pressure, temperature, and system integrity.
- Vacuum Chambers: Enclosed environments where vacuum processes occur.
The Critical Role of Membranes in Vacuum Technology
Among the most essential vacuum system parts are membranes, which serve as flexible, durable barriers that isolate the process environment from external factors. The right membranes can significantly enhance process efficiency, reduce leaks, and extend equipment lifespan.
Types of Membranes Used in Business Applications
- Silicone Membranes: Known for their excellent flexibility, chemical resistance, and stability across a temperature range. Ideal for sealing and pressure regulation in sensitive processes.
- Rubber Membranes: Offer high durability and elasticity. They are widely used in applications requiring reliable sealing under heavy mechanical stress.
- Natural Rubber Membranes: Valued for their high resilience and sealing capacity, particularly suited for environments with varying pressure needs.
- Specialty Membranes: Customized membranes designed for specific chemical or temperature challenges encountered in unique applications.

The Role of the becker dry vane vacuum pump in Industrial Processes
The becker dry vane vacuum pump stands out among vacuum pumps due to its robust engineering, reliability, and efficiency. It is a dry pump, meaning it does not require lubricants that could contaminate sensitive processes, making it ideal for applications in food, pharmaceuticals, and electronics manufacturing.
